Duolingo says lagar mat = cooks. Should I just use lagar?
@agatonlinguisticssvenskala16632 жыл бұрын
Duolingo is right. In order to say "to cook" you have to say "att laga mat". However, "laga" can also be used with a specific dish instead, e.g. "att laga köttbullar" = to cook meatballs.
